概括
本研究引入了两种新的算法,以优化化学工业集群,确定促进经济效益和减少可持续化学制造对环境的影响的共生关系.

背景情况:
- 化学工业集群 (CICs) 提供了通过共生来优化资源和减少废物的机会.
- 实现化学工业的可持续性需要最大限度地提高经济效益并最大限度地减少对环境的影响.
- 目前的CIC可能无法充分利用潜在的共生关系以提高效率.
研究的目的:
- 为化学工业集群设计和验证创新的共生算法.
- 量化实施优化共生关系的经济和环境效益.
- 在CIC中为污染和碳减排战略提供理论支持.
主要方法:
- 开发CIC的最长路径算法和最大共生算法.
- 将算法应用于具有569种原材料和435种产品的原型CIC.
- 分析化学特征,流动模式和集群内的现有关系.
主要成果:
- 最长路径算法确定了一个5家企业的染料产业链.
- 最大共生算法揭示了218个共生对,增加了910万的化学物质.
- 共生关系带来了12.5亿元人民币的成本节约和0.62-11.87倍的生命周期效益.
结论:
- 开发的算法有效地优化CIC,以提高经济和环境绩效.
- 实施共生算法有助于实现化学工业的可持续性目标.
- 这种跨学科的方法为工业集群中的污染和碳减排提供了基础.

The rate theory of chromatography provides quantitative insight into the shapes and widths of elution bands. These bands are based on the random-walk mechanism governing molecular migration within a column. The Gaussian profile of chromatographic bands arises from the cumulative effect of random molecular motions as they progress through the column.

Fluid flow analysis is critical in many scientific and engineering disciplines, and two principal approaches are used to describe this flow: the Eulerian and Lagrangian methods. These methods offer different perspectives on monitoring and analyzing the motion of fluids, each with distinct advantages depending on the scenario.

Plane potential flows simplify fluid motion by assuming the fluid to be irrotational and incompressible. These characteristics allow these flows to be described by a velocity potential function, ϕ, representing the flow speed in a given direction, and a stream function, ψ, that visualizes the flow path, both governed by Laplace's equation. These parameters help in estimating flow patterns, velocity distributions, and pressure fields around various hydraulic structures.

Multipipe systems consist of complex configurations of interconnected pipes designed to transport fluids efficiently across intricate networks. They are essential in engineering applications requiring precise control over flow distribution, pressure, and head loss. They are categorized into series, parallel, loop, and network configurations, each distinguished by unique flow characteristics and applications.
